Bagrot Valley, nestled deep in the Karakoram mountain range, is a hidden paradise just 40 kilometers from Gilgit, Pakistan. With its lush green fields, crystal-clear rivers, majestic glaciers, and warm local culture, Bagrot Valley offers an unforgettable escape for trekking enthusiasts, nature lovers, and cultural explorers. This untouched haven remains one of the best-kept secrets in northern Pakistan.

🥾 Trekking in Bagrot Valley: A Gateway to Glaciers and Peaks

Adventure seekers will find Bagrot Valley to be a true trekking paradise. The valley is surrounded by iconic peaks like Rakaposhi (7,788m) and Diran (7,266m) and is home to several scenic trails of varying difficulty levels.

🔹 Popular Trek: Kutwal Lake

One of the most famous routes leads to Kutwal Lake, a pristine alpine lake with panoramic views of Rakaposhi Glacier. This trek takes you through picturesque villages, suspension bridges, and glacier-fed streams.

🧕 Cultural Experience: Meet the People of Bagrot

The people of Bagrot are known for their hospitality, strong community values, and centuries-old traditions. Visitors can learn about local agriculture, seasonal festivals, and traditional house-building techniques.

You may also taste organic local foods, such as apricot-based dishes and butter tea, while staying in locally-run guesthouses that offer a homestay experience.

📍 How to Reach Bagrot Valley

Bagrot Valley is easily accessible from Gilgit City. A 4×4 vehicle is recommended, as the narrow mountain roads can be rugged, especially during rainy seasons.

  • Distance: ~40 km from Gilgit
  • Transport: Local jeeps or private 4WD
  • Best Time to Visit: May to October
